如何在Vue项目下装Nginx·你需要安装·确保你已经在本地安装了Nginx

如何在Vue项目下安装Nginx?

要在Vue项目下安装Nginx,你可以按照以下简单的步骤进行操作,让你的Vue项目运行得更加高效和稳定。

一、安装Nginx软件包

你需要安装Nginx软件包。不同操作系统的安装方法略有不同,以下是一些常见操作系统的安装步骤:


Ubuntu/Debian

```bash sudo apt update sudo apt install nginx ```

CentOS/RHEL

```bash sudo yum install nginx ```

macOS(通过Homebrew)

```bash brew install nginx ```

Windows

1. 下载Nginx的Windows版本:[Nginx下载页面]() 2. 解压下载的文件到指定目录,例如C:\nginx。 3. 打开命令提示符,进入Nginx目录,运行命令: ```bash nginx ```

二、配置Nginx服务器

安装完成后,你需要配置Nginx以服务你的Vue项目。Nginx的配置文件通常位于`/etc/nginx/nginx.conf`或`/etc/nginx/sites-available/default`。以下是一个简单的Nginx配置示例:

```nginx server { listen 80; server_name yourdomain.com; location / { root /path/to/your/vue/project; index index.html index.htm; try_files $uri $uri/ /index.html; } } ```

在此配置中,将`yourdomain.com`替换为你的域名,将`/path/to/your/vue/project`替换为Vue项目的构建目录。

三、部署Vue项目到Nginx服务器

1. 构建Vue项目:

```bash npm run build ```

这将生成一个目录,包含了你的生产环境代码。

2. 上传构建文件:

将构建目录中的所有文件上传到Nginx服务器的指定目录(例如`/var/www/yourdomain.com`)。

四、启动Nginx并访问Vue项目

1. 启动Nginx:

```bash sudo systemctl start nginx ```

或者,如果Nginx已经在运行,重新加载配置:

```bash sudo systemctl reload nginx ```

2. 访问Vue项目:

打开浏览器,访问你的域名或IP地址,你应该能够看到你的Vue应用程序。

通过以上步骤,你可以成功地在Nginx服务器上安装并部署Vue项目。主要步骤包括安装Nginx、配置Nginx服务器、构建和上传Vue项目、启动Nginx服务器。这些步骤确保你的Vue项目能够在生产环境中稳定、高效地运行。

进一步建议

相关问答FAQs

问题1:如何在Vue项目中安装Nginx?

确保你已经在本地安装了Nginx。你可以从Nginx官方网站下载适合你操作系统的安装包,并按照官方文档的指引进行安装。

问题2:为什么要在Vue项目中安装Nginx?

在Vue项目中安装Nginx有以下好处:

问题3:有没有其他替代Nginx的服务器软件?

除了Nginx,还有一些其他的服务器软件可以用来部署Vue项目,例如:

选择哪种服务器软件来部署Vue项目,取决于你的具体需求和技术栈。